Mixed Xylene Market Size

The global Mixed Xylene Market Size was valued at USD 69,490.49 million in 2024 and is projected to reach USD 74,556.35 million in 2025, expanding to USD 130,905.72 million by 2033. The market is growing at a CAGR of 7.29% during the forecast period (2025-2033), driven by increasing demand in petrochemical applications and solvent production.

The US Mixed Xylene Market Size is expected to witness steady growth due to rising industrial activity, increased use in chemical intermediates, and expanding refinery capacities.

The mixed xylene market is witnessing steady growth, driven by its extensive application in automotive, petrochemical, and paints & coatings industries. The rising demand for high-octane fuels is boosting consumption, as mixed xylene serves as a key component in gasoline blending.

Additionally, the solvent industry is increasingly utilizing mixed xylene due to its high solvency power. The market is also seeing significant growth in Asia-Pacific, accounting for over 50% of global consumption, driven by rapid industrialization and increasing demand from the construction sector. Moreover, sustainability initiatives are pushing manufacturers towards bio-based xylene alternatives, which are expected to shape the future of the market.

Segmentation Analysis

The mixed xylene market is segmented based on type and application, catering to various industrial needs. By type, the market is categorized into solvent grade and isomer grade, with each type serving specific applications. By application, mixed xylene is widely used in fuel blending, solvents, thinners, and as a raw material for petrochemicals. Among these, fuel blending accounts for over 45% of total consumption, driven by its use in enhancing gasoline performance. Additionally, solvents and thinners contribute nearly 30% of the market demand, primarily from the paints & coatings and industrial sectors. These segments continue to shape the global market demand.

By Type

  • Solvent Grade Mixed Xylene: Solvent grade mixed xylene is widely utilized in the paints & coatings, adhesives, and industrial solvent sectors, accounting for over 35% of global mixed xylene consumption. Due to its strong solvency power, it is a preferred choice in chemical and pharmaceutical applications. The Asia-Pacific region contributes nearly 50% of the total solvent-grade mixed xylene consumption due to its strong industrial base. Additionally, rising demand for eco-friendly solvent alternatives is pushing companies to invest in low-VOC solvent-grade xylene. Europe has also witnessed a 15% increase in demand for solvent-grade mixed xylene in automotive coatings and specialty chemicals applications.
  • Isomer Grade Mixed Xylene: Isomer-grade mixed xylene is primarily used for paraxylene production, which accounts for over 60% of its global demand. Paraxylene is a key feedstock in the polyester and PET resin industries, driving its consumption in textile and plastic packaging applications. The Asia-Pacific region dominates isomer-grade mixed xylene consumption, contributing over 55% of global demand, primarily due to the rapid expansion of the polyester industry in China and India. Additionally, North America’s demand for isomer-grade xylene has increased by 20% in the last decade, driven by rising PET packaging usage in the food and beverage sector.

By Application

  • Fuel Blending: Fuel blending is the largest application of mixed xylene, contributing over 45% of the total market demand. The automotive and transportation sectors drive this demand due to mixed xylene’s role in enhancing gasoline octane ratings. The Asia-Pacific region alone accounts for nearly 50% of fuel-blending consumption due to rapid urbanization and rising automotive production. Additionally, government regulations on fuel quality improvements are pushing refiners to increase oxygenate additives like mixed xylene. In North America, fuel blending applications have grown by 15% in recent years, supported by stricter emission norms and fuel efficiency standards.
  • Solvents: Mixed xylene is a widely used industrial solvent, accounting for nearly 30% of global consumption. It is commonly utilized in paints, coatings, adhesives, and printing inks, with the Asia-Pacific region consuming over 55% of total solvent applications. The rise of water-based and low-VOC solvents has, however, slightly impacted demand, leading to a 10% shift towards eco-friendly alternatives in Europe. In the North American market, solvent applications have increased by 12%, driven by growing demand in the construction and furniture sectors. The Middle East & Africa also sees steady growth, with solvent usage rising by 8% annually.
  • Thinners: Thinners represent a significant portion of mixed xylene demand, with over 20% of the total market share. They are extensively used in paint thinners, industrial coatings, and varnishes. The Asia-Pacific region leads in consumption, accounting for 50% of global thinner demand, primarily due to expanding construction and furniture industries. The European market has seen a 10% increase in demand for low-VOC xylene thinners as part of strict environmental regulations. North America follows closely, with a 15% rise in demand for premium-grade industrial thinners, particularly in the automotive refinishing and wood coatings sectors.
  • Raw Material: As a raw material, mixed xylene is crucial for paraxylene, orthoxylene, and metaxylene production, contributing to over 60% of the total market demand. The polyester and PET industries are the largest consumers of paraxylene, with Asia-Pacific dominating over 55% of the global market. In Europe, PET demand has risen by 18% due to growing food and beverage packaging needs. North America has also experienced a 12% increase in demand for mixed xylene as a feedstock in chemical production and resins. Additionally, the Middle East & Africa is seeing growing demand, with paraxylene applications rising by 10% annually.

Mixed Xylene Regional Outlook

The mixed xylene market is geographically segmented into North America, Europe, Asia-Pacific, and the Middle East & Africa, with Asia-Pacific leading global consumption, holding over 55% of the total market share. The North American market accounts for nearly 20%, driven by fuel blending and chemical industry applications. Europe contributes over 15%, supported by rising demand in specialty solvents and coatings. Meanwhile, the Middle East & Africa is witnessing moderate growth, with a 10% increase in paraxylene applications. Regional expansions and increasing investment in sustainable production technologies are shaping the future of the mixed xylene market.

North America 

North America holds around 20% of the global mixed xylene market, with the United States leading consumption. The demand is primarily driven by fuel blending, accounting for over 45% of the region’s usage. Additionally, the chemical industry contributes to 30% of the region’s mixed xylene demand. Stringent environmental regulations have led to a 12% increase in bio-based solvent alternatives. Canada and Mexico are emerging players, with Mexico’s demand growing by 15% annually due to rising industrial production and automotive sector growth. The U.S. continues to expand its refining capacity, with mixed xylene output increasing by 10% in the past five years.

Europe 

Europe accounts for approximately 15% of the global mixed xylene market, with Germany, France, and the UK being the key consumers. Solvent applications dominate, holding a 35% market share, driven by rising demand for coatings, adhesives, and industrial chemicals. PET resin consumption in Europe has surged by 18%, pushing up paraxylene demand. Stringent environmental norms have resulted in a 10% decline in conventional solvent-based applications, shifting focus to bio-based alternatives. The Eastern European market is witnessing a 12% growth, fueled by expanding manufacturing and automotive sectors, while Western Europe is focusing on sustainable production methods.

Asia-Pacific 

Asia-Pacific dominates the mixed xylene market, holding over 55% of global consumption, driven by China, India, Japan, and South Korea. China alone accounts for nearly 40% of the regional demand, mainly for paraxylene production. The Indian market has seen a 20% increase in demand, fueled by rising PET consumption. Additionally, South Korea and Japan contribute 25% of regional mixed xylene exports, supporting growing polyester and chemical industries. The paints & coatings sector in Southeast Asia is experiencing a 15% growth rate, further propelling mixed xylene demand. Government initiatives in China aim for a 12% reduction in solvent emissions.

Middle East & Africa 

The Middle East & Africa hold approximately 10% of the global mixed xylene market, with Saudi Arabia, the UAE, and South Africa as key contributors. The region’s demand has grown by 10% annually, primarily driven by paraxylene exports and petrochemical applications. The GCC countries account for over 60% of mixed xylene production in the region, supporting growing polyester and fuel blending industries. South Africa has witnessed a 12% rise in solvent-based applications, particularly in automotive coatings. Additionally, investment in refining and petrochemical projects across the region is expected to boost production capacity by 15% in the next decade.
